Yang Jing, an alternate member of the 16th Central Committee of the Communist Party of China (CPC), became the acting chairman of the Regional People's Government of the Inner Mongolia Autonomous Region, north China, Thursday.

His appointment came at the second meeting of the Standing Committee of the 10th Regional People's Congress of Inner Mongolia.

Yang, of the Mongolian ethnic group, was a member of the Standing Committee of the CPC Regional Committee of Inner Mongoliaand secretary of the CPC City Committee of Hohhot, the regional capital, before taking over the new job.

He once served as the chairman of the Youth Federation of the Inner Mongolia Autonomous Region.
